用mariadb官方源下载mariadb。
[root@business-backup ~]# vim /etc/yum.repos.d/mariadb.repo [mariadb] name = MariaDB baseurl = http://yum.mariadb.org/10.2/centos7-amd64 gpgkey=https://yum.mariadb.org/RPM-GPG-KEY-MariaDB gpgcheck=1
然是用yum下载mariadb:
yum install MariaDB-server MariaDB-client -y
2.创建需要使用的data目录。我在这边创建了两个,一个用于3306端口,一个用于3307.
mkdir /data/newoa/data -pv mkdir /data/travel/data/ -pv chown -R mysql:mysql /data/
3.初始化两个数据库:
mysqld --initialize-insecure --datadir=/data/newoa/data --user=mysql mysqld --initialize-insecure --datadir=/data/travel/data/ --user=mysql
4.初始化后再启动,启动成功后连接数据库并修改root@localhost用户的密码,然后退出。
ALTER USER ‘root‘@‘localhost‘ IDENTIFIED BY ‘123456‘;
5.修改两个配置文件,处理的newoa以及travel目录是自己创建:
[root@business-backup ~]# vim /etc/my.cnf.d/newoa/my.cnf [mysqld] port=3306 datadir=/data/newoa/data socket=/data/newoa/data/mysql.sock server_id=201 log-bin=mysql-bin binlog_format=mixed relay-log = relay-bin user=mysql [mysqld_safe] log-error=/data/newoa/data/mysqld.log pid-file=/data/newoa/data/mysqld.pid [root@business-backup ~]# vim /etc/my.cnf.d/travel/my.cnf [mysqld] port=3307 datadir=/data/travel/data socket=/data/travel/data/mysql.sock server_id=207 log-bin=mysql-bin binlog_format=mixed relay-log = relay-bin user=mysql [mysqld_safe] log-error=/data/travel/data/mysqld.log pid-file=/data/travel/data/mysqld.pid
6.创建启动脚本。
以下是3306实例的管理脚本/etc/init.d/mysqld3306,内容修改自原有管理脚本/etc/init.d/mysqld。由于我是yum安装的,所以mysql的basedir为/usr,如果是编译安装或通用二进制安装,则对应修改下面脚本中的basedir变量。将此管理脚本复制为/etc/init.d/mysqld3307,再修改下port=3307即可作为3307实例的服务管理脚本。$datadir以及cnf的路径做修改。
[root@business-backup ~]# vim /etc/init.d/mysqld3306
#!/bin/sh
#
# mysqld This shell script takes care of starting and stopping
# the MySQL subsystem (mysqld).
#
# chkconfig: 345 64 36
# description: MySQL database server.
# processname: mysqld
# Source function library.
. /etc/rc.d/init.d/functions
# Source networking configuration.
. /etc/sysconfig/network
basedir=/usr
exec="$basedir/bin/mysqld_safe"
prog="mysqld"
port=3306
datadir="/data/newoa/data"
socketfile="$datadir/mysql.sock"
errlogfile="$datadir/mysqld.log"
mypidfile="$datadir/mysqld.pid"
cnf="/etc/my.cnf.d/newoa/my.cnf"
# Set timeouts here so they can be overridden from /etc/sysconfig/mysqld
STARTTIMEOUT=120
STOPTIMEOUT=60
# Set in /etc/sysconfig/mysqld, will be passed to mysqld_safe
MYSQLD_OPTS=
[ -e /etc/sysconfig/$prog ] && . /etc/sysconfig/$prog
lockfile=/var/lock/subsys/$prog
case $socketfile in
/*) adminsocket="$socketfile" ;;
*) adminsocket="$datadir/$socketfile" ;;
esac
start(){
[ -x $exec ] || exit 5
# check to see if it‘s already running
RESPONSE=$(/usr/bin/mysqladmin --no-defaults --socket="$adminsocket" --user=UNKNOWN_MYSQL_USER ping 2>&1)
if [ $? = 0 ]; then
# already running, do nothing
action $"Starting $prog: " /bin/true
ret=0
elif echo "$RESPONSE" | grep -q "Access denied for user"
then
# already running, do nothing
action $"Starting $prog: " /bin/true
ret=0
else
# Now start service
$exec $MYSQLD_OPTS --defaults-file="$cnf" --datadir="$datadir" --socket="$socketfile" --pid-file="$mypidfile" --basedir="$basedir" --user=mysql >/dev/null &
safe_pid=$!
# Spin for a maximum of N seconds waiting for the server to come up;
# exit the loop immediately if mysqld_safe process disappears.
# Rather than assuming we know a valid username, accept an "access
# denied" response as meaning the server is functioning.
ret=0
TIMEOUT="$STARTTIMEOUT"
while [ $TIMEOUT -gt 0 ]; do
RESPONSE=$(/usr/bin/mysqladmin --no-defaults --socket="$adminsocket" --user=UNKNOWN_MYSQL_USER ping 2>&1) && break
echo "$RESPONSE" | grep -q "Access denied for user" && break
if ! /bin/kill -0 $safe_pid 2>/dev/null; then
echo "MySQL Daemon failed to start."
ret=1
break
fi
sleep 1
let TIMEOUT=${TIMEOUT}-1
done
if [ $TIMEOUT -eq 0 ]; then
echo "Timeout error occurred trying to start MySQL Daemon."
ret=1
fi
if [ $ret -eq 0 ]; then
action $"Starting $prog: " /bin/true
touch $lockfile
else
action $"Starting $prog: " /bin/false
fi
fi
return $ret
}
stop(){
if [ ! -f "$mypidfile" ]; then
# not running; per LSB standards this is "ok"
action $"Stopping $prog: " /bin/true
return 0
fi
MYSQLPID=`cat "$mypidfile"`
if [ -n "$MYSQLPID" ]; then
/bin/kill "$MYSQLPID" >/dev/null 2>&1
ret=$?
if [ $ret -eq 0 ]; then
TIMEOUT="$STOPTIMEOUT"
while [ $TIMEOUT -gt 0 ]; do
/bin/kill -0 "$MYSQLPID" >/dev/null 2>&1 || break
sleep 1
let TIMEOUT=${TIMEOUT}-1
done
if [ $TIMEOUT -eq 0 ]; then
echo "Timeout error occurred trying to stop MySQL Daemon."
ret=1
action $"Stopping $prog: " /bin/false
else
rm -f $lockfile
rm -f "$socketfile"
action $"Stopping $prog: " /bin/true
fi
else
action $"Stopping $prog: " /bin/false
fi
else
# failed to read pidfile, probably insufficient permissions
action $"Stopping $prog: " /bin/false
ret=4
fi
return $ret
}
restart(){
stop
start
}
condrestart(){
[ -e $lockfile ] && restart || :
}
# See how we were called.
case "$1" in
start)
start
;;
stop)
stop
;;
status)
status -p "$mypidfile" $prog
;;
restart)
restart
;;
condrestart|try-restart)
condrestart
;;
reload)
exit 3
;;
force-reload)
restart
;;
*)
echo $"Usage: $0 {start|stop|status|restart|condrestart|try-restart|reload|force-reload}"
exit 2
esac
exit $?使用以下命令管理实例:
service mysqld3306 {start|stop|status|restart}
